2. Safety Instructions
Please read all safety instructions carefully before using the appliance. Failure to follow these instructions may result in electric shock, fire, or serious injury.
- Always place the dispenser on a stable, flat, heat-resistant surface, away from the edge of the countertop.
- Do not immerse the appliance, power cord, or plug in water or any other liquid.
- Keep out of reach of children. This appliance features a child safety lock, but adult supervision is always recommended.
- Do not operate the appliance if the power cord or plug is damaged, or if the appliance malfunctions or has been damaged in any way.
- Always unplug the dispenser from the power outlet before cleaning, filling, or when not in use.
- Exercise extreme caution when handling hot water. Steam and hot water can cause severe burns.
- Do not fill the water tank above the maximum fill line.
- Only use cold tap water in the water tank. Do not add other liquids or additives.
- Ensure the drip tray is correctly positioned before dispensing water.
- This appliance is for household use only.

4. Setup
- Unpacking: Carefully remove the dispenser from its packaging. Retain packaging for future storage or transport.
- Placement: Place the appliance on a dry, stable, and level surface, ensuring adequate ventilation around the unit. Keep it away from walls and other appliances.
- Initial Cleaning: Before first use, remove the water tank and drip tray. Wash them with warm soapy water, rinse thoroughly, and dry. Wipe the exterior of the main unit with a damp cloth.
- Fill Water Tank: Remove the water tank from the main unit. Fill it with fresh, cold tap water up to the MAX line. Do not overfill.
- Reattach Water Tank: Securely place the filled water tank back onto the main unit. Ensure it clicks into place.
- Position Drip Tray: Place the drip tray onto the base of the dispenser.
- Power Connection: Plug the power cord into a grounded electrical outlet. The digital display will illuminate.
- First Use Cycle (Cleaning): For the first use, it is recommended to run at least two full cycles of hot water (100°C, 500ml) without consuming the water, to clean the internal components. Dispose of this water safely.

5. Operating Instructions
The Ocina Hot Water Dispenser features an intuitive digital display for easy operation.
General Operation:
- Power On: Ensure the dispenser is plugged in and the water tank is filled. The display will show the default settings or the last used settings (Memory Function).
- Select Temperature: Use the temperature control buttons on the digital display to select your desired water temperature (from 25°C to 100°C).
- Select Volume: Use the volume control buttons to choose the desired water volume (from 100 ml to 500 ml).
- Dispense Water: Place your cup or container on the drip tray. Press the dispense button to start heating and dispensing. The appliance will stop automatically once the selected volume is reached.
- Stop Dispensing: To stop dispensing before the selected volume is reached, press the dispense button again.
Special Functions:
- Child Safety Lock: To activate or deactivate the child safety lock, press and hold the designated lock button on the control panel for a few seconds. When activated, the dispense button will not function until unlocked.
- Baby Milk Function: This function provides water at an optimal temperature for preparing baby formula (typically around 40°C). Select this preset function from the digital display for precise preparation.
- Memory Function: The dispenser automatically saves your last used temperature and volume settings, allowing for quick and convenient dispensing without re-adjusting settings each time.

6. Maintenance
Regular cleaning and maintenance will ensure the longevity and optimal performance of your Ocina Hot Water Dispenser.
Daily Cleaning:
- Drip Tray: Empty and clean the drip tray regularly, especially after each use if spills occur. The drip tray is removable for easy cleaning.
- Exterior: Wipe the exterior of the appliance with a soft, damp cloth. Do not use abrasive cleaners or solvents.
Water Tank Cleaning:
- Remove the water tank from the unit.
- Wash the tank with warm soapy water and a soft brush or sponge.
- Rinse thoroughly with clean water to remove any soap residue.
- Dry completely before reattaching to the main unit. The water tank is dishwasher compatible.

Descaling:
Limescale buildup can affect the performance and lifespan of your dispenser. The anti-limescale notification will alert you when descaling is necessary.
- Unplug the appliance and ensure it has cooled down.
- Empty any remaining water from the tank.
- Fill the water tank with a descaling solution suitable for kettles (e.g., white vinegar and water, or a commercial descaler) according to the descaler's instructions.
- Place a large heat-resistant container under the dispensing spout.
- Run a full dispensing cycle (100°C, 500ml) to allow the descaling solution to pass through the system.
- Repeat the process if necessary, or let the solution sit for a recommended time as per descaler instructions.
- After descaling, rinse the water tank thoroughly and run at least two full cycles with fresh, clean water to flush out any descaling residue. Dispose of this water safely.
7. Troubleshooting
If you encounter issues with your dispenser, refer to the following table for common problems and solutions.
| Problem | Possible Cause | Solution |
|---|---|---|
| Dispenser does not turn on. | Not plugged in; Power outage; Faulty outlet. | Ensure the power cord is securely plugged into a working outlet. Check your circuit breaker. |
| Water is not dispensing. | Water tank empty; Water tank not properly seated; Child safety lock activated. | Fill the water tank. Ensure the water tank is correctly installed. Deactivate the child safety lock. |
| Water is not hot enough. | Incorrect temperature setting; Limescale buildup. | Adjust the temperature setting to a higher value. Perform a descaling cycle. |
| Slow dispensing or reduced flow. | Limescale buildup; Clogged spout. | Perform a descaling cycle. Clean the dispensing spout. |
| Anti-limescale notification is on. | Appliance requires descaling. | Perform a descaling cycle as described in the Maintenance section. |
| Water leakage from the base. | Drip tray full or improperly placed; Water tank not sealed correctly. | Empty and correctly position the drip tray. Re-seat the water tank firmly. If leakage persists, contact customer support. |
